Where To Eat Lunch When You’re On Jury Duty

"Want to eat poké in a place that looks a boutique that would sell expensive t-shirts and also have a matcha bar? Come to Humble Fish, another good poké spot in the area, which has plenty of seating. The toppings here are kind of fancy: your bowl might come with trout roe, kale chips, or a rice crisp that looks like a crazy sea creature." - hillary reinsberg
